About Olav Keerberg
Olav Keerberg is a scholar working on Plant Science, Global and Planetary Change and Biochemistry, having authored 21 papers that have together received 779 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(15 papers), Plant responses to elevated CO2 (11 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Plant Science (536 citations), Biochemistry (60 citations) and Molecular Biology (567 citations). Olav Keerberg has collaborated with scholars based in Estonia, Sweden and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Tiit Pärnik, Hermann Bauwe, Katja Morgenthal, Wolfram Weckwerth, Per Gardeström, Vaughan Hurry, Stefan Timm, Stefanie Wienkoop, Leszek A. Kleczkowski and Adriano Nunes‐Nesi. Their work appears in journals such as The Plant Cell, PLANT PHYSIOLOGY and Journal of Experimental Botany.
